Description
Milia removal treatment of those pesky tiny cysts that form on the skin when dead skin cells get trapped under the skin’s surface. These can appear as pearly-white or flesh-colored bumps on the face.
Milia are not harmful and but do require professional treatment to remove. Though milia often go away on their own, it can be months, years or more. For this reason, people prefer to get milia removed for cosmetic reasons. Typical areas are cheeks and around the eye region.
Never attempt to remove a milia on your own as they can be stubborn and cause permanent scarring or infection.
